Probability theory

Probability theory is a branch of mathematics concerned with the analysis of random phenomena. It also provides the mathematical tools for modeling the noisy nature of the data as well as understanding any related aspects.

The current themes of research in probability theory within the division of Mathematical Statistics include:

- Large deviations and analysis of rare events
- Random matrices
- Stochastic analysis
- Stochastic control and games
- Extreme value theory.
